Locale : Small Town -- An incorporated place or CDP with a population less than 25,000 and greater than or equal to 2,500 and located outside a CMSA or MSA.
Institution Type : Public -- At least 2 but less than 4 years
Calendar System : Semester -- A calendar system that consists of two semesters during the academic year with about 16 weeks for each semester of instruction. There may be an additional summer session.

Carnegie Classification : Associate’s Colleges -- These institutions offer associate’s degree and certificate programs but, with few exceptions, award no baccalaureate degrees.
Regional Accreditation : Yes  -- North Central Association of Colleges and Schools, The Higher Learning Commission
State Accreditation or Approval Agency : Yes
National or Specialized Accreditation Agency : Implied no

Degrees/Certificates Offered :Postsecondary award, certificate or diploma of at least one but less than two (at least 900 but less than 1800 contact or clock hours)
Associate's Degree
